October isn’t just about Halloween—it’s also the vibrant, heartfelt celebration of Dia de los Muertos (Day of the Dead). This joyous Mexican tradition honors loved ones who’ve passed with colorful altars, elaborate costumes, and striking decor that mesmerizes the senses. 2. Grand Marigold Landscape Accent

Marigolds (cempasúchil) aren’t just decorations—they guide spirits home with their vivid orange hue and fragrant presence. Create a focal point by gathering piles of fresh or dried marigold petals in bowls, hanging garlands, or framed wall art. Use them to frame your altar or accent shelves for a chaotic yet beautiful harmony reminiscent of ancestral traditions.
3. Bold Color Palettes on Every Surface
Dia de los Muertos bursting with vivid colors—marigold orange, royal purple, deep red, and verdant green. Use these colors on throw pillows, table runners, napkins, and even frosted candles. Consider a gradient effect: deep purple skies transitioning into orange blooms. This visual explosion instantly makes your space memorable and culturally rich.

4. Sugar Skull Photo Collages & Skull Cranes
Turn personal photos into meaningful tribute pieces by crafting hand-painted or custom-printed sugar skulls. Frame them in a grid or scatter around altars for a deeply personal touch. Pair with carved wooden skull cranes suspended above tables—each serving as both decorative art and spiritual reminder of life’s continuity.
5. Edible Art: Mexica-Inspired Centerpieces
Why not make decor functional? Design edible centerpieces using marzipan sugar skulls, licorice “candles,” or decorated chicles (gum) shaped into flowers and hearts. Arrange them on wooden platters layered with lightly candied flowers (like roses or chrysanthemums) for a sensory experience your guests won’t forget. Celebrate both flavor and tradition!
6. Golden Lighting for Dramatic Impact
Soft, warm lighting sets the mood. Hang translucent paper lanterns (like papel picado) over doorways or windows, illuminated by flickering warm LED string lights resembling fire. Add polished silver or bronze intricate candle holders placed strategically—either real or modern interpretations—to reflect light dramatically, echoing traditional candlelit vigils.
